Default Profit UI Self Installer

Created this today.

Ver 1.0

Based off of Profit UI version v3.4.8b.
Includes Backdrops for Persona Window.
Allows user to use default install or choose the installation path.

Ver 1.1

EQ2.ini file is now overwritten if it already exists in the Everquest II folder.
If installing over a existing Profit UI install the old files will now be updated.



Installation is very easy. Just down load the above file. Unzip it and run the installer. If you have Everquest II installed in a differant directory just browse to it.

After the installer runs launch Everquest II.
NOTE: If you already are running EQ2 Maps you will need to repatch so it downloads the EQ2map files to your ProfitUI folder.

Once in game all of your windows are gonna be crazy all over the place.

Type /load_uisettings

You should get a window that pops up with a bunch of files in it.

Pick the ProfitUI_Best resolution that fits your screen ( Example: ProfitUI_1280x1024_eq2_uisettings.ini)

Once you pick your resolution file BAM your using profit.

I have included all the orginal profit files there are some parts of this mod you may not like such as the BANK window and the INVENTORY windows. They are pretty damn small.

If thats the case just go to your everquest II folder. Then go to the UI folder and then ProfitUI folder.

Look for the following files and delete them:

eq2ui_inventory_bank.xml
eq2ui_inventory_inventory.xml

This will return those two files back to the default UI.
